Transaction 22b39a317a4e15ba16e18d6d721b059ef08e9d89fc91f38c5b79b4d4dfcf3df5

2 Input
1 Outputs
  • 22b39a317a4e15ba16e18d6d721b059ef08e9d89fc91f38c5b79b4d4dfcf3df5:0
  • value  2886233
    address  34kfvzvamn3wp8oXQJFyeugFBDcwcLUnSE